J.J. Abrams Talks About Star Trek Into Darkness, Says He Can Not be More Excited About the Movie

Features

By GustavoLeao / 13:38, 15 September 2012 / Star Trek: Nemesis

Star Trek Into Darkness director J.J. Abrams was on NBC's today show this morning and briefly spoke about Star Trek.

When asked if he could give any hints about the new Star Trek movie, Abrams jokingly stated that it "would come out" and that it would be set "partially in space".

Abrams went on to comment that "it was too early to talk about details" of the new movie, and that he "can not be more excited about Star Trek".
